Dorothy Helen McGregor 1912–1985 – Genealogical Records

Birth Date: 20 Dec 1912

Birth Location: Albuquerque, NM

Death Date: 12 Mar 1985

Death Location: San Bernardino

Father:

Mother: Mary Dobell

Spouse(s): John Hartline

Children(s):

In 1912, Dorothy Helen McGregor entered the world in Albuquerque, NM, born to Harry Mcgregor And Mary Emma Dobell. In 1930, Dorothy Helen McGregor resided in Albuquerque, Bernalillo, New Mexico, USA. In 1935, Dorothy Helen McGregor resided in Rural, Bernalillo, New Mexico. Dorothy Helen McGregor married John Ramath Hartline, and had children including Jean D Hartline, Ruth E Hartline. Dorothy Helen McGregor passed away in 1985 in San Bernardino.
